Job Description

The Hospital Director at Hometown Veterinary Partner is a member of hospital team and reports directly to the President. The Hospital Director will support our core beliefs of Culture, Collaboration and Community. You are empowered to provide exceptional veterinary care that is approachable, accessible, and individualized in your location. As a respected member of the leadership team, this leader is also responsible to lead and manage successful outcomes and advancements in operations, team management, client services, and marketing to build the HVP brand. Culture Maintain a positive, supportive, and collaborate work environment. Interpersonal and conflict resolution skills to support an inclusive environment. Hire, retain, train, and develop medical staff. Onboard new team members Training hospital teams on workflows and systems Problem-solving with team members on cultural and operational issues to improve safety and efficiency and work environment. Provide ongoing leadership that supports efficiency, productivity, and well-being. Identifying opportunities and developing operational best practices to drive organic growth and fiscal sustainability Community Implement customer retention and engagement strategies and tactics. Provide a positive and exceptional client experience. Manage community involvement and philanthropy efforts. Engage and/or lead in marketing activities such as photography, social media, and local event participation. Collaboration Give input, ideas, and suggestions for continual improvement of the practice environment for the care team, patients, and pet parents. Guide and utilize exceptional support staff. Serves as an integrating force that fosters alignment of the healthcare team to support evidence-based, safe, high-quality, and cost-effective care for the community we serve. Familiarity with quality, safety, and health initiatives Ensuring all licenses are up to date, and in accordance with state or federal guidelines. Ensuring the medical staff and facility comply with the federal rules and regulations.
